Dust Jacket Condition: dj. First Edition. First edition and first printing. Hardcover. 79 pages. Published in conjunction an exhibition that ran November 12 through December 22, 2006. Features acknowledgements by Susanne Ghez, an essay by Catherine M. Soussloff and the text of Hamza Walker's interview of Gest. Includes numerous color images, list of previous exhibitions, list of grants and awards, and a bibliography. A fine copy in a fine dust jacket. Digitally-assembled imagery that aspires to change the current "conversation" between photography and painting (whereby the former now dominates the latter) by adopting painting's spatial perspective to arrive at a new way of creating, not just taking, photographs. "Captures his lone sitters at the chance interstices of deep reflection, when the self dwells in thought. The construction of the self as it happens before Gest's camera serves to question the construction of that self in reality. Gest uses digital photography to monumentalize photography's ability to capture such fleeting moments. Each photograph is seamlessly constructed from hundreds of digital images of the sitter and their surroundings. The photographs' initial straightforward appearance can only be maintained at a cursory glance. Gest's subtle and not-so-subtle exaggerations of proportion and perspective quickly betray the images as Mannerist constructions" (Publisher's blurb). With their static character, the photographs recall the ground-breaking work of Philip-Lorca DiCorcia (achieved by Gest using elaborate digital manipulation rather than elaborate actual production) yet have a contemplative, thoughtful quality all their own. Individually and cumulatively, they remind us of the necessity of pressing the "pause" button, especially those of us who routinely go about our affluent, hectic social lives.
